    It's called a refeed and every five days is extremely excessive. I do a refeed every four months or so. The secret is not to "pig out", but to eat a lot of carbs (and a good range along the glycemic index), moderate protein, and low fat (<50g). This will spike your leptin sensitivity, which is especially important if you've been restricting carbs. Fat inhibits leptin from crossing the blood brain barrier so that's why it's important to keep fat low.

    Doing it the way you've described may work for a while, but I'm pretty lean right now so it has to be much more controlled.
